Why Communication Skills Matter In Software Engineering Interviews

 thumbnail

Why Communication Skills Matter In Software Engineering Interviews

Published Mar 21, 25
8 min read
[=headercontent]20 Common Software Engineering Interview Questions (With Sample Answers) [/headercontent] [=image]
Software Engineer Interview Topics – What You Need To Focus On

How To Break Down A Coding Problem In A Software Engineering Interview




[/video]

There is likewise a graduate version, 6.042 J, which you can do if 6.006 is as well very easy for you. And this is for the 4th kind of interview rounds - you might have one more layout (object oriented or systems) round or a math round (I had to prepare both for Microsoft), and I will certainly repeat the exact same thing right here - it is so essential to go back to the essentials.

As you can now envision - this is a great deal of preparation. And that is why you need to start ahead of time. If you await that interview phone call, you will have less than 2 weeks in a lot of instances to prepare on your own and I will certainly leave that up to you to make a decision if that is sufficient for you.

Fact be informed, I have more models and versions of my return to than I wish to confess. However reflecting, I don't think there is any shame in that. The factor I got every one of those meetings and after that, the details groups that I wished to work in was as a result of that single sheet of resume that I uploaded on the initial day.

Return to writing is an ability, and one that requires to build. There are no accreditations that can help you do that, just experimentation. Mistake in these affordable times is practically deadly so the following best point is obtaining feedback. Do not hesitate of rejection from your peers.

the listing goes on. Completion objective is to have one common copy of your return to all set which has been prepared such that it demonstrates all of your skills, and other individuals can see that. You can currently tweak this according to the business you are applying to and the certifications that they are searching for.

The benefit of making use of LeetCode, whether you enjoy it or dislike it, is that it has formats of concerns most often utilized by tech firms in coding rounds. The technique is to build a skill that can aid you decode - given this trouble, what are the algorithms in my "toolbox" that I can make use of to address this problem.

Software Engineer Interview Topics – What You Need To Focus On

If I needed to offer you my own instance, I have not even touched 200 questions on LeetCode myself and I assume I did quite well in my meetings. The other resource that people like to make use of is Breaking the Coding Interview. I have that book, I believe it is excellent, I simply have actually never ever had the ability to use it myself.

Actual meetings will certainly have at least one more person, if not more and it is vital that you have actually exercised giving the meeting to one other individual (and not simply your monitor). Technical Meetings are not just about writing the best code and making certain it compiles, you will also have to discuss your idea procedure and why you are doing what you are doing.

Common Mistakes To Avoid In A Software Engineer Behavioral Interview

Why Faang Companies Focus On Problem-solving Skills In Interviews


In some cases if you are running out of time and can not complete the code, however can discuss what your intents are, you could still obtain away and clear that round. I will certainly go back to the same thing that I stated is very important for your resume: comments. We are all terrified of failure and allowing a person else understand what our imperfections are, but much better a friend/peer than than the interviewer.

How To Think Out Loud In A Technical Interview – A Guide For Engineers

It will certainly help me make content far better matched to the requirements of the people going to. If you have particular questions concerning any component of the procedure, drop them here too!.

However this is still indicated to be a sensible, not theoretical, conversation. Attract from your previous experience and use exact examples to clarify what you would do and why. And like all of our meeting inquiries, it will certainly be made to "ladder," indicating your job interviewer's follow-ups can get moreor lesschallenging as you progress.

Top Coding Interview Mistakes & How To Avoid Them

Interview Prep Guide For Software Engineers – Code Talent's Complete Guide


This belongs to how we examine learning agility; we would like to know just how well you assume on your feet. In the supervisor interview, we'll chat concerning that you are todayand that you intend to be at Atlassian. Naturally, throughout the interview process, we want to make certain we learn more about prospects as humansand we want them to be familiar with us.

How To Crack Faang Interviews – A Step-by-step Guide

In this sessionusually one-on-one with either the hiring manager or an extra senior supervisor on the teamwe'll ask concerns made to recognize not just that you are, but additionally what you're interested in and thrilled around. We'll speak about just how you can include worth not only in the duty and group you're obtaining, yet in your long-lasting occupation at Atlassian.

We'll likewise use this session to discover as much as we can around just how you function, especially your partnership and interaction designs. Make certain you're prepared to talk regarding a past task or more, from that you collaborated with to the technical challenges you needed to overcome. You can additionally talk with the business validation for the projectthe reason you were working with it in the first area.

So remember, we're below to help you, not to stump you. If you do not understand what to do, state so! Communication and collaboration are key skills on our group, so just consider it as another chance to reveal your things. The worths interview is designed to evaluate your positioning withand address your concerns aboutAtlassian's 5 worths.

The Best Engineering Interview Question I've Ever Gotten – A Real-world Example

How Much Time Should A Software Developer Spend Preparing For Interviews?


The latter changes as we expand, and differs from office to office. But our worths remain the exact same. They're the foundation on which a sustainable firm is constructed. And since our worths are woven right into our techniques, processes, and the method we run our teams, your values interviewer likely won't be a member of the group you're relating to sign up with; it could be somebody from Sales, HUMAN RESOURCES, or Client Assistance.

Our objective is to comprehend your attitude, and the method it overviews your actions. After efficiently completing the meeting procedure, your recruiters will consolidate responses and debrief. If there's a good fit in between your abilities and experience, you will proceed to the last in the process - being evaluated by a Hiring Board.

Tips For Acing A Technical Software Engineering Interview

Atlassian hiring committee participants are different from the interviewers you will satisfy and just have accessibility to specific info connecting to the interview process (this consists of interview comments and CV info). The employing board will look holistically at abilities, staminas and behaviours, guaranteeing an objective employing decision. As you undergo this procedure, we want you to have a great experience - and we want to do whatever we can to draw out the very best in you, since it's your ideal that will determine exactly how you can contribute to our group.

Communication and collaboration are crucial abilities on our group, so simply think of it as one more opportunity to reveal your things. Rather, we're bringing in individuals with a vast range of skills, backgrounds, and point of views, and providing them every feasible chance to put their ideal foot ahead.

The Science Of Interviewing Developers – A Data-driven Approach

Data Science Vs. Data Engineering Interviews – Key Differences


Ample preparation not just enhances your confidence but also helps you showcase your experience and attract attention from the competitors. This is where ChatGPT action in. Developed by OpenAI, ChatGPT is an amazing device that can transform your interview prep work experience. With its considerable expertise and conversational abilities, ChatGPT becomes your trusted companion, giving valuable guidance, insights, and assistance throughout your trip.

Facebook Software Engineer Interview Guide – What You Need To Know

This blog aims to lead software application engineers on how to utilize ChatGPT successfully for interview preparation. From gathering interview information to practicing technical questions and improving soft skills, this blog will certainly help you make the most of ChatGPT as a beneficial resource. By the end of this blog site, you will have a clear understanding of just how to effectively use ChatGPT to improve your possibilities of success in software program designer meetings.

These meetings analyze your capacity to develop scalable and efficient software program systems. You may be asked to detail the style, components, and scalability considerations for a given situation. These focus on examining your soft abilities, including interaction, synergy, an analytical method, and social fit within the organization. You might be inquired about previous experiences, difficulties, and just how you take care of different circumstances.

It has the prospective to be a helpful source for software application programmers who are preparing for interviews. ChatGPT can assist in preparing meeting questions, practicing technical troubles, and enhancing soft abilities to its massive data base and ability to generate pertinent and insightful answers. ChatGPT can be a remarkable source for meeting preparation, providing countless opportunities to improve your readiness.

The Best Websites To Practice Coding Interview Questions

ChatGPT offers as your digital interviewer, providing you an immersive prep work experience with its interactive and vibrant conversational capacities. "I'm currently getting ready for a task interview in (Work Title). Could you please play the function of interviewer and ask me some concerns? Please ask me (Number of Concerns) concerns, individually:"Usage ChatGPT to Practice Mock Meeting "As a (Your Function) prospect, I am currently planning for this setting.

Could you please produce interview concerns associated with these ideas to aid me practice?" Have a look at this real-time ChatGPT discussion: If you anticipate interview inquiries however lack the responses, ChatGPT can be a beneficial source. It can create feedbacks to help you recognize and plan for those concerns, supplying important understandings to help you improve your knowledge and readiness.